UPS driver fired after racist rant on family porch: report

A UPS driver who was caught on video ranting racially while delivering a package to a Latino family in Milwaukee has reportedly been fired.

Hugo Aviles, a police officer, was asleep when he received a report from his security camera showing the UPS driver spitting out the racist comments on his porch on Dec.17, The Washington Post reported.

“Now you don’t understand anything, because you are a stupid m – who cannot read and write and do not speak the English language,” the driver reportedly says in the recording.

Shirley Aviles, 45, the police officer’s mother, said she had no doubt the UPS driver was talking about her 23-year-old son.

“He has never met my son,” the mother told The Washington Post. He bases it exclusively on the Latino surname. He meant it. He sent it back. It was malicious. “

On Tuesday, UPS announced that it had fired the driver. The company has not disclosed the driver’s identity.

His resignation came after activists in Milwaukee held a press conference demanding that the company take action.

“There is no place for racism, bigotry, or hatred in any community,” a UPS spokesperson told NBC News. “This is very serious and we took immediate action and terminated the driver’s employment.”
